Public universities in Kenya are facing an immense financial crisis, burdened by debts exceeding Sh100 billion, severely hampering their operations. The Controller of Budget, Margaret Nyakang'o, has issued a stern warning regarding the alarmingly low absorption rate of development funds by several counties, with some counties using under 3% of budgets. This underutilization is hindering crucial development projects across the country.
